Understanding Turbidity and Its Implications

Water turbidity refers to the cloudiness or haziness of a liquid caused by a variety of suspended particles, such as sediment, microorganisms, and other pollutants. Turbidity is measured in Nephelometric Turbidity Units (NTUs) and serves as a useful indicator of water quality. High turbidity levels can signal the presence of harmful bacteria, viruses, and other contaminants, making the water unsafe for consumption and potentially leading to health issues.

Turbidity can arise from natural sources, such as runoff from rainstorms or soil erosion, or from human activities, such as construction, agricultural practices, and wastewater discharge. For homeowners relying on well water or municipal sources, it's essential to monitor turbidity regularly to ensure drinking water is safe and clean. In this context, turbidity meters become valuable tools.

A turbidity meter typically works by shining a light through a water sample and measuring how much of that light is scattered by particles suspended in the water. The more light scattered, the higher the turbidity reading. Homeowners can use this information to make informed decisions about water treatment options, explore potential contamination sources, and take practical steps to improve water quality.

Turbidity testing aligns with broader health concerns. Low turbidity usually indicates that water is clear and likely free from harmful pathogens, whereas elevated turbidity can suggest water is not adequately treated and could pose a risk of disease transmission. Considerations Before Purchasing a Turbidity Meter

Before diving into the decision to purchase a turbidity meter, potential buyers should evaluate several factors influencing their choice. One significant aspect is the type of meter that best fits their needs. Turbidity meters can be categorized into two main types: portable meters and bench-top models. Portable meters are compact and easy to use, making them ideal for field testing and immediate assessments. Bench-top models, on the other hand, are typically more precise and suited for laboratory-like settings. Homeowners should consider their typical testing conditions and whether portability or stability is more critical.

Additionally, the measurement range of a turbidity meter is crucial. Different meters have varying capabilities, with some effectively measuring low turbidity levels while others can handle more turbid samples. Individuals must assess their water quality conditions to select a meter that accommodates their expected turbidity ranges, as inaccurate readings could lead to faulty conclusions.

It’s also essential to consider the device's calibration requirements and overall maintenance. Some turbidity meters require regular calibration for accurate readings, a task that may involve additional costs and time commitments.
